Here are my 5 top tips for your wedding day
Please don’t keep checking the weather apps
I am sorry to say this one is beyond anyone’s control. We always pray for the sun but sometimes the weather has a mind of it’s own! By obsessing over the weather you’re only going to drive yourself crazy, and you’ll end up putting all your focus and energy over something you can’t control. If it rains it makes for great photos, your photographer will capture pictures you never dreamed of, embrace it. Take 10 minutes to really take it in that you have got married!!!

I usually take you to a private space after the ceremony so you can take it all in. The ceremony can be a bit of a whirlwind and it’s just lovely to have a few moments with your new husband or wife!

Invest in good suppliers
There is nothing worse than cutting corners with a photographer or band (depending on what’s important to you) and then being disappointed afterwards, you can’t get this day back or do it all over again. There are other smarter ways to utilise your money, and save so that you can have the most epic dream team working on your wedding. Good suppliers will make your wedding even better, they spend so much time with you on your wedding you’ll want them to be part of your squad!

Just let go, and go with the flow
You’ve done all the hard working of planning. You have to trust that it will all come together, be present and enjoy every minute. Because trust me it will fly by and you don’t want to waste any of it worrying or being anxious.
